

Lonnie was born December 9, 1925 to Manuel and Mary Martinez in Lovell, Wyoming. The family moved to Colorado Springs when Lonnie was just two years old. He attended Colorado Springs High School. At 18, Lonnie joined the Navy and spent World War II stateside working in an ammunition arsenal in Babbitt, Nevada. During his time in the Navy he was a Golden Gloves Boxer only loosing one fight throughout his boxing career. It was in Babbitt, Nevada that he met the love of his life, Vivian and took her for his bride on June 2, 1945.
Lonnie and Vivian returned to his hometown upon being discharged from the Navy. He began his long career in the automotive industry starting as a mechanic at Marksheffel Motor Company. He then moved to Perkins Motor Company where he faithfully served customers for 40 years. His joy and passion was to be in the business of serving others. His infectious smile and laugh greeted the members of Church for All Nations for over 35 years. He always had words of encouragement or affirmation for those he came across.
